Becalm in a sentence
Synonym: calm, still. Antonym: agitate
Meaning: To make a ship motionless by preventing wind from filling the sails.

Becalm meaning
Becalm is a verb that means to make calm or still, to soothe or pacify. It is often used in nautical contexts, referring to the calming of the wind or sea. However, it can also be used in a more general sense to describe the act of calming or soothing someone or something. Here are some tips for using becalm in a sentence:
1. Use it in a nautical context: Becalm is most commonly used in a nautical context, referring to the calming of the wind or sea.
For example, "The captain ordered the crew to becalm the sails in order to navigate through the calm waters."
2. Use it to describe a calming effect: Becalm can also be used to describe the act of calming or soothing someone or something.
For example, "The sound of the waves becalmed her nerves and she felt at peace."
3. Use it in a figurative sense: Becalm can also be used in a figurative sense to describe the calming of emotions or situations.
For example, "The mediator's words becalmed the tense negotiations and a compromise was reached."
4. Use it in the past tense: Becalm is a regular verb, so it follows the standard conjugation rules. In the past tense, it becomes "becalmed." For example, "The storm becalmed the sea, leaving the sailors stranded for days."
